“Ipes House Vray for Rhino” is a 2-day event – the workshop consists of two consecutive sections, an 8-hour familiarization with the work environment, an 8-hour training course for rendering the exterior scene of the house.

Ipes House – Vray for Rhino Master class is a 2 day rendering course of an exterior architectural visualisation. This 16-hour course is designed for everyone who is interested in gaining visualization skills, resulting in a professional level photorealistic exterior scene. Students follow a linear process from understanding image composition and color theory, to creating and controlling lighting set-ups and reproducing physical accurate materials. Workshop will conclude with post-production techniques and tricks in Photoshop. Information will flow in an accelerated pace.
The overall process will be close enough to the beginner level so that even people who have not work with related programs so far will be easily able to follow. It is strongly recommended to attend the whole course to get a complete understanding of the workflow until the result. Any experience with Rhinoceros interface helpful but not required.

Structure

In this training course you will learn to create photorealistic exterior visualizations, using the V-ray for Rhino render engine. This fast moving class covers most of V-ray’s functionality, regarding exterior scene setup. You will systematically move through, the Rhino/V-ray interface, understand different V-ray light types, create an array of physical accurate materials in V-ray, get familiar with image quality parameters, thus acquiring concrete knowledge for coping with any exterior visualization, regardless complexity of the scene. The duration of the course is 16 hours. The course in intensive and spans 2 consecutive days. (Sat – Sun 10:00 to 18:00).

Expected Outcomes

After this course the student is expected to be able to:
Move comfortably around the V-ray for Rhino menus.
Understand different V-ray light types and scene-lighting techniques.
Create your very own custom materials from scratch.
Understand sampling quality concepts and efficiently alternate between different setups.
Produce raw image files and utilize VFB channels.
Bring “to life” your images through basic post-production steps in Photoshop.

Curriculum

At decode™ effective training is achieved through a real-life project setting instead of generic exercises. All V-ray material will be taught by getting the Studio MK27 Ipes House scene ready for final render. In this way each student will be guided through the experience of completing a challenging and interesting visualization project, building up knowledge and confidence for dealing with various scene setups, just like a professional would. Through the Hover House rendering steps the following concepts will be covered:

  • Get acquainted with the Rhino viewports.
  • Navigate around model space.
  • Rhino layering system for rendering purposes.
  • V-ray camera set-up.
  • Global Illumination(GI) lighting.
  • Lighting the scene with V-ray lights.
  • Material editor
  • Image sampling techniques- DMC Sampler
  • Indirect illumination-Primary/Secondary bounces calculation algorithms
  • V-ray frame buffer
  • Photoshop layers composition and basic post production techniques.

  • V-ray Option Editor
  • Global Switches
  • Glossy Effects
  • Materials Override
  • V-ray physical camera: shutter speed, aperture, film ISO, white balance
  • Environment lighting set-up: GI(skylight), Vray SunLight System , HDRI Lighting Method
  • Color mapping: Linear multiply, Reinhard
  • VFB channels: RGB, Alpha, RenderID, Extra Tex, Light mix
  • Output: Image aspect ratio, get view aspect
  • Indirect Illumination(GI): Irradiance map, Light cache, Brute force
  • Ambient occlusion
  • V-ray Fur Object

V-ray Lights

  • V-ray sunlight system
  • HDRI based lighting
  • Rectangular lights
  • Dome lights
  • IES lights
  • Light Generator

  • Material Creation & Texture mapping
  • Create standard material
  • Create your very own custom materials from scratch
  • Diffuse color/map slot
  • Transparency
  • Reflection: Color/TexFresnel, Glossiness
  • Refraction: IOR, Glossiness
  • Emmisive materials
  • Apply materials to geometry
  • Texture mapping: box mapping, surface mapping, cylindrical mapping, spherical mapping
  • Match mapping
  • Assigning coordinates

Target Audience:
This course is for architects, interior and industrial designers and of course design enthusiasts who want to efficiently learn the concepts and features of the Rhinoceros modelling software and V-ray for Rhino render engine at an accelerated pace in an instructor-led environment.

Pre-requisites:
Requires Windows skills and desire to produce stunning visuals. Previous experience with Rhinoceros interface helpful but not required. If trainees have attempted to work through tutorials on either evaluation, student or commercial version of V-ray for Rhino, this will help.)
